Back to newsTwo minor earthquakes struck Crete in the early morning hours, with a 3.7 magnitude tremor recorded near Lasithi in the eastern part of the island and a 3.8 magnitude tremor near Chania in the west. Both events occurred close together in time during the predawn hours.
Earthquakes of this size are common in Crete and the broader eastern Mediterranean region, which sits on an active seismic zone. Tremors below magnitude 4.0 rarely cause structural damage and are often not felt by people who are asleep. No reports of damage or injuries have been issued.
Tourists staying in the affected areas need not be alarmed. Standard precautions apply: if you feel shaking, stay calm, move away from windows, and follow guidance from local authorities or hotel staff if tremors intensify.
